Donnelly offers a measured and cogent contribution to what I would prefer to call the emerging discipline of writing studies. - TEXT, Vol 16, No 2, October 2012 - Jeremy Fisher, University of New England, Armidale Dianne Donnelly is the editor of Does the Writing Workshop Still Work?
(2010) and co-editor of Key Issues in Creative Writing (forthcoming).
The book is divided into three parts: Section 1: A Taxonomy of Creative Writing Pedagogies; Section 2: The Writing Workshop Model; and Section 3: The Academic Home of Creative Writing Studies.

In addition, future creative writers will develop their skills in expressing creatively, develop their art of characterisation, and discover the secrets of writing a successful short story.
Programmes in creative writing also help students to develop their individual writing and self-editing skills for any form of writing creation and to obtain an understanding of the history of fiction and non-fiction writing.
Creative writing helps students expand imagination, creativity, originality and written communication skills.
Graduates can find jobs in the field as fiction writers, play writers, screenwriters, song writers (lyricists), columnists, bloggers, and more.
